Output 2efcca049a7b7b3df8cd6f01d2d23ea890127aa95ea7286d68765bffcd9a1f1e:1

value
108696
script pubkey
OP_0 OP_PUSHBYTES_20 08c683fe0efa8a6eb869308980dd3a9ca7c2b16d
address
bc1qprrg8lswl29xawrfxzycphf6njnu9vtdf8gxmh
transaction
2efcca049a7b7b3df8cd6f01d2d23ea890127aa95ea7286d68765bffcd9a1f1e
confirmations
81423
spent
true